added a configuration via config.xml file
All checks were successful
continuous-integration/drone/push Build is passing

* the config file contains the Mensa name and URL, the Cachet Base-URL and API-Key
This commit is contained in:
2019-10-28 18:39:44 +01:00
parent 3177be1bf0
commit dd064d63af
4 changed files with 154 additions and 21 deletions

View File

@ -28,6 +28,7 @@ import org.mosad.thecitadelofricks.controller.CacheController.Companion.getLesso
import org.mosad.thecitadelofricks.controller.CacheController.Companion.getLessonSubjectList
import org.mosad.thecitadelofricks.controller.CacheController.Companion.getTimetable
import org.mosad.thecitadelofricks.controller.CacheController.Companion.mensaMenu
import org.mosad.thecitadelofricks.controller.StartupController
import org.mosad.thecitadelofricks.controller.StatusController.Companion.getStatus
import org.mosad.thecitadelofricks.controller.StatusController.Companion.updateMensaMenuRequests
import org.mosad.thecitadelofricks.controller.StatusController.Companion.updateTimetableRequests
@ -52,7 +53,8 @@ class APIController {
}
init {
CacheController() // initialize the CacheController
StartupController()
CacheController()
}
// TODO remove this with API version 1.2.0